Zeynel A Karcioglu, MD, Ophthalmology

2 Hospital Dr
CharlottesvilleVA  22908-0001 (Charlottesville City County)


Phone: 434-924-5485
Fax: 434-924-5180

NPI: 1326098286
License Number: 40953 (TN)